Did you know you can help our school just by shopping for groceries at Food City? 🛒 Every Box Top you earn adds up to real dollars that support our students with food through the Family Resource Center! 🙌
🧾 Here’s how you can help:
1️⃣ Link your Food City ValuCard to our school at FoodCity.com/schoolbucks
2️⃣ Shop at Food City and earn School Bucks points with every purchase
3️⃣ Food City donates those points back to our school — it’s that easy! 🎉
Let’s work together to make every grocery trip count! 🍎
Thank you for supporting our students and families through the Flat Gap Family Resource Center ❤️
